Injured goat put to sleep

The goat had been attacked by dogs and was badly hurt

An injured goat was found in open veld in Stevenson Road on Saturday morning (December 31).

The goat had been attacked by dogs and was seriously hurt.

A concerned community member spotted the animal and realising it was in distress, alerted Annamarie Koen of the Animal Anti-Cruelty League (AACL).

League workers immediately went out and took the goat to the vet, with the help of community members.

The animal was ‘put down’ due to the serious injuries it had sustained.
